Output ec75acc93702b7db965d6aa7e3852fa4d1feadde760cf97d4e50a91402467fcd:6

value
171943732
script pubkey
OP_0 OP_PUSHBYTES_20 40cd01ec778742cb97ad690da85cf2a8dcf84ca6
address
bc1qgrxsrmrhsapvh9addyx6sh8j4rw0sn9xtur9uq
transaction
ec75acc93702b7db965d6aa7e3852fa4d1feadde760cf97d4e50a91402467fcd
confirmations
182758
spent
true